Kimber Shray Promoted to Vice President of Marketing for GP PRO

GP PRO, a division of Georgia-Pacific, announced today that it has promoted Kimber Shray to vice president of marketing. In this role, Shray will lead GP PRO’s marketing team and guide sales enablement initiatives.

Shray has been with Georgia-Pacific for 11 years. Most recently, she led GP PRO’s customer marketing and segment insights team, where she was largely responsible for optimizing the company’s integrated sales, marketing and category planning process and supporting its proprietary insight-based selling platform, GPXperience. Prior to that, she was an integral member of the company’s Digital Core team, which oversaw an enterprise-wide digital transformation initiative. Specifically, Shray led the roll-out of SAP Marketing Cloud and co-led the SAP Hybris Commerce launch. She also spent several years working on Georgia-Pacific’s retail division. Her earlier career experience includes positions with Heinz and MatchPoint Marketing.

 

About GP PRO
Based in Atlanta, Georgia-Pacific and its subsidiaries are among the world’s leading manufacturers and marketers of bath tissue, paper towels and napkins, tableware, paper-based packaging, office papers, cellulose, specialty fibers, building products, and related chemicals.  The company operates approximately 150 facilities and employs approximately 30,000 people directly and creates nearly 80,000 jobs indirectly. GP PRO, a division of Georgia-Pacific, manufactures and sells well-known brands like ActiveAire®, Angel Soft® Professional Series, Brawny®, Compact®, Dixie®, Dixie Ultra®, enMotion®, and Pacific Blue™.
